A silver ingot weighing 2.1 kg is held by a string so s to be completely immersed in a liquid of relative density `0.8`. The relative density of silver is `10.5`. The tension in the string in `kg-wt` is

A

`1.6`

B

`1.94`

C

`3.1`

D

`5.25`

Text Solution

Verified by Experts

The correct Answer is:
B

Apparent weight `=V(rho-sigma)g =(M)/(rho) (rho-sigma)g = M(1-(sigma)/(rho))g = 2.1(1-(0.8)/(10.5))g = 1.94 g`
Newton `= 1.94 kg-wt`
